Question Playing Back 16:9 & 4:3 Correctly

Hey everyone,

I've been trying to get this TV to display both 16:9 and 4:3 correctly under 1 setting.
It does put the digital TV content in the right aspect ratio, like not stretching 4:3 into 16:9 and all.
However, for the BD-player and the PS3 connected, it simply stretches any 4:3-content.
Is there any way I can fix this or will I have to keep switching at every change of aspect-ratio?

Also, without changing the settings, any 4:3-DVD is displayed correctly.
However, try a BD such as 'The Matrix', playback the bonus-content and it's stretched.
(I'm not sure if it's with all of them, but the bunch I tried this is the case.)
